shingle
uncountable noun: Shingle is a mass of small rough pieces of stone on the shore of a sea or a river. shingle in American English 1 large, coarse, waterworn gravel, as found on a beach noun: a thin piece of wood, slate, metal, asbestos, or the like, usually oblong, laid in overlapping rows to cover the roofs and walls of buildings shingle in American English 2 a thin, wedge-shaped piece of wood, slate, etc. laid with others in a series of overlapping rows as a covering for roofs and the sides of houses to cover (a roof, etc.) with shingles noun: small, waterworn stones or pebbles such as lie in loose sheets or beds on a beach shingle in American English 3 to work on (puddled iron) by hammering and squeezing it to remove impurities transitive verb: to hammer or squeeze (puddled iron) into a bloom or billet, eliminating as much slag as possible; knobble shingle in British English 1 noun: a thin rectangular tile, esp one made of wood, that is laid with others in overlapping rows to cover a roof or a wall shingle in British English 2 noun: coarse gravel, esp the pebbles found on beaches shingle in British English 3 verb: to hammer or squeeze the slag out of (iron) after puddling in the production of wrought iron |
